Recycling machines are specialized devices designed to process waste materials—such as plastics, metals, glass, and organic matter—into reusable forms. These machines play a crucial role in transforming discarded items into valuable resources, thereby supporting the principles of a circular economy. By automating the recycling process, these machines enhance efficiency, reduce human error, and increase the volume of materials that can be processed.
In today's world, the importance of recycling machines cannot be overstated. They address several pressing issues:
Environmental Protection: By processing waste materials, recycling machines help reduce landfill usage and decrease pollution.
Resource Conservation: They enable the recovery of valuable materials, reducing the need for virgin resources.
Economic Benefits: Efficient recycling can lead to cost savings and the creation of new industries and jobs.
Consumer Engagement: Machines like reverse vending units incentivize individuals to participate in recycling efforts.
These machines are integral to waste management systems worldwide, ensuring that more materials are recycled and less are wasted.
The recycling industry has seen significant advancements in recent years:
AI Integration: In 2025, Waste Management launched an AI-assisted recycling facility in Portland, Oregon, enhancing sorting accuracy and efficiency.
Metal Recycling Innovations: Companies like Aurubis and JX Advanced Metals are investing in advanced recycling technologies to process complex materials, aiming to reduce reliance on traditional mining.
Consumer Incentive Programs: Ireland's bottle deposit return scheme, introduced in 2024, has seen a dramatic increase in container returns, highlighting the effectiveness of incentive-based recycling.
These developments reflect a global shift towards more efficient and sustainable recycling practices.
Recycling machines operate within a framework of laws and policies that vary by region:
Extended Producer Responsibility (EPR): Many countries have implemented EPR policies, requiring manufacturers to take responsibility for the end-of-life management of their products.
Mandatory Recycling Programs: Some regions have established mandatory recycling programs, compelling businesses and households to recycle certain materials.
Plastic Bag Bans and Restrictions: Numerous jurisdictions have enacted bans or restrictions on single-use plastics to reduce environmental impact.
Deposit Return Schemes: Programs like Ireland's bottle deposit return scheme encourage consumers to return beverage containers for recycling, often incentivized with refunds or rewards
These regulations aim to enhance recycling rates and reduce waste, influencing the design and operation of recycling machines.

Q1: What materials can be recycled using machines?
A1: Recycling machines can process a wide range of materials, including plastics, metals, glass, paper, and organic waste. The specific capabilities depend on the type of machine.
Q2: How do reverse vending machines work?
A2: Reverse vending machines accept used beverage containers, such as bottles and cans, and provide incentives like refunds or rewards to encourage recycling.
Q3: Are recycling machines cost-effective?
A3: While the initial investment in recycling machines can be significant, they often lead to long-term savings by reducing waste disposal costs and recovering valuable materials.
Q4: Can recycling machines handle all types of waste?
A4: No, recycling machines are designed to process specific types of materials. It's important to use the appropriate machine for each waste category to ensure effective recycling.
